    How to Choose the Right Option

    Start with your ride style and weather. Daily commuter? Look for quick on/off and low-profile comfort. Touring or weekend trips? Aim for features that fight fatigue and changing conditions. If you’re customizing, match components that complement your bike and how you ride.

    Frequently Asked Questions About Gloves

    What protection should a motorcycle glove include?

    Abrasion‑resistant palms, palm sliders, reinforced seams, and impact protection at knuckles/fingers. Short‑cuff vs gauntlet depends on coverage/weather.

    How should gloves fit?

    Snug with full finger reach and no numbness; slight break‑in is normal. Too loose and armor can rotate away in a slide.

    Summer, three‑season, or winter—how to choose?

    Summer gloves prioritize airflow; three‑season balance protection/venting; winter gloves add insulation/weatherproofing. Heated liners are great for cold commutes.

    Touchscreen compatible?

    Many include conductive fingertips; responsiveness varies by model.

    Care tips?

    Spot‑clean, air‑dry, condition leather; follow brand guidance for waterproof membranes.
